John McAfee, the former security-software mogul wanted by police in connection to a murder in Belize last weekend, stays on the lam because Belize authorities will execute him. At least that's what the 67-year-old fugitive told The Telegraph in a phone interview from an unknown location. "What one can expect is that GSU ... will beat me soundly until I confess to a multitude of sins ... and then just simply execute me," he said, adding that he did not kill his neighbor. "Good Lord. I just cannot conceive of myself doing anything like that." McAfee has also been communicating with Wired magazine, describing his evasion tactics: lying on the floors of taxis and traveling by boat, to name a few.
